M1 Whole Cell Lysate is derived from the M1 cell line, which originates from a murine myeloid leukemia model. This cell line is characterized by its myeloblastic properties and is often utilized to study the cellular and molecular mechanisms underlying myeloid differentiation and proliferation. The lysate itself is a rich mixture of cellular components, including proteins, RNA, lipids, and other small molecules, extracted by lysing M1 cells. In research contexts, M1 Whole Cell Lysate serves as a valuable resource in biochemical and molecular biology studies, particularly in understanding signal transduction pathways and gene expression related to myeloid cells. Researchers employ this lysate as a reference material in proteomics studies to analyze protein expression and modifications, and it is frequently used as a control in various assay systems. Its application extends to the study of cellular responses to external stimuli, such as cytokines or growth factors, which are critical for elucidating the mechanisms of leukemic progression and cellular responses in myeloid cells. By providing a snapshot of the cellular machinery of M1 cells, this lysate facilitates a deeper understanding of leukemia at the molecular level, assisting researchers in exploring fundamental biological processes.
